As used in this chapter, the following terms shall have the meanings indicated:
AGRICULTRUAL LANDThe land and on-farm buildings, equipment, manure-processing and -handling facilities, and practices that contribute to the production, preparation and marketing of crops, livestock and livestock products as a commercial enterprise, including a commercial horse boarding operation and timber processing. Such farm operation may consist of one or more parcels of owned or rented land, which parcels may be contiguous or noncontiguous to each other.
CLEAN WOODWood that has not been painted, stained, or treated with any other coatings, glues or preservatives, including, but not limited to, chromated copper arsenate, creosote, alkaline copper quaternary, copper azole or pentachlorophenol.
MANUFACTURERAny person who makes or produces a new outdoor woodburning furnace that is ultimately operated in the Village of Delhi.
OUTDOOR WOODBURNING FURNACEAn accessory structure, equipment, device or apparatus, designed and intended, through the burning of wood, solid waste or other fuels, for the purpose of heating and/or supplying hot water to the principal structure or any other site, building, or structure on the premises. For purposes of this chapter, an outdoor woodburning furnace includes, but it not limited to, woodburning furnaces, woodburning boilers or gasification units.
REFUSEAny animal, vegetable, or mineral, solid, liquid, or gaseous waste. It includes, but is not limited to, rubbish, garbage, ashes and any unwanted or discarded material.
SEASONED WOODHardwood, such as hickory, ash, maple or oak that has been cut, split or stacked to promote drying and air circulation for a minimum of one year.
